About This Home
Welcome to this impressive 4-bedroom, 4-full bathroom home in Shreveport, offering spacious living areas, quality finishes, and exceptional indoor and outdoor amenities. Inside, you'll find hardwood flooring throughout the main living spaces, a formal living room with a fireplace, and a formal dining room perfect for gatherings and entertaining. The kitchen features granite countertops, custom cabinetry, premium appliances, and tile flooring, providing both functionality and style. Just off the kitchen, the hearth room offers a second fireplace and a comfortable space to relax. Upstairs, a versatile bonus room comes equipped with a projector and screen, making it ideal for a media room, game room, home office, or flex space to fit your needs. The backyard is designed for enjoyment year-round, featuring a heated saltwater pool, outdoor kitchen, and pergolas that create an inviting setting for outdoor dining and entertaining. Additional features include granite surfaces and custom cabinetry throughout the home, providing a cohesive and well-appointed feel from room to room. Welcome to Shreveport, a historic city nestled along the Red River. Founded in 1836 as a steamboat port, Shreveport offers housing options from Highland neighborhood bungalows to downtown apartments. Current rental trends show moderate growth, with average one-bedroom apartments renting for $881, reflecting a 6.5% annual increase, while two-bedroom units average $1,026. The city features outdoor spaces like Betty Virginia Park and the R.W. Norton Art Gallery's botanical gardens, perfect for year-round recreation.
Shreveport's cultural landscape includes the restored Strand Theatre and the Louisiana State Exhibit Museum. The presence of Centenary College, Louisiana State University Shreveport, and Southern University adds to the educational environment. Established neighborhoods include South Highlands, with its canopy of oak trees and historic architecture, and Provenance.
